Friendly Place Resource Center

Hakalau, HI

Friendly Place Resource Center

HOPE Services Hawaiʻi

Friendly Place Resource Center is dedicated to providing urgent support and emergency assistance to individuals and families experiencing homelessness in Hakalau, HI, and the surrounding West Hawai'i area. Our services include nutritious meals, laundry facilities, and access to showers, as well as essential mail services and case management support. We also offer a phone for job-related calls and resources for housing solutions, alongside lockers for personal belongings when available. Our welcoming environment empowers those in need to access the resources necessary for stability and independence.
